Title :
Configuring requirements-compliant multi-agent systems
Author :
Rho, Sue ; Rosset, Sebastien ; Redmond, Timothy
Author_Institution :
Cougaar Software Inc., Mountain View, CA, USA
Abstract :
This paper describes Proteus, a tool set that allows users to build distributed multi-agent systems by selecting system properties, ranging from availability of critical components, performance characteristics, desired level of communication protection (encrypt, signature, specific algorithms), policies for society objects (e.g., messages, black-board objects, files, databases) and certificate authorities. Proteus then analyzes selected properties for consistency and tries to resolve them autonomously using previously provided resolution rules. The user is notified of any conflicts Proteus could not resolve for guidance. Once properties are deemed to be resolved, Proteus can generate system policies as well as the configuration files (e.g. XML files) that can be used to deploy the system.
Keywords :
certification; configuration management; formal specification; knowledge engineering; multi-agent systems; security of data; Proteus tool set; certificate authority; communication protection; compliant multi-agent system; critical components; distributed multi-agent system; performance characteristics; system configuration requirement; system consistency; system properties; Availability; Cryptography; Distributed databases; Engines; Government; Hardware; Multiagent systems; Ontologies; Protection; XML;
Conference_Titel :
Multi-Agent Security and Survivability, 2005 IEEE 2nd Symposium on
Print_ISBN :
0-7803-9447-X
DOI :
10.1109/MASSUR.2005.1507048